Tree canopy thinning involves selectively removing branches and foliage from a tree to reduce its overall density. This process aims to improve air circulation within the canopy, allow more sunlight to reach the ground below, and promote healthier growth. Professionals performing this service assess the structure of each tree to determine the appropriate branches to prune, ensuring that the tree’s stability and health are maintained throughout the process. Proper canopy thinning can enhance the tree’s appearance while also supporting its long-term vitality.

This service helps address several common problems associated with overgrown or dense tree canopies. Excessively thick foliage can impede airflow, creating a damp environment that may foster disease or pest infestations. It can also lead to increased risk of branch breakage during storms due to the weight of the foliage. Additionally, dense canopies can block sunlight from reaching lawns and gardens, impacting plant growth and landscape aesthetics. Thinning can mitigate these issues by reducing weight and improving the overall health and safety of the trees.

The overview below groups typical Tree Canopy Thinning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Reno, NV.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Initial Assessment - The cost for a tree canopy thinning assessment typically ranges from $100 to $300, depending on the size and number of trees. Larger or more complex properties may incur higher fees. Local pros can provide a tailored estimate based on specific site conditions.

Basic Thinning Service - Basic canopy thinning services usually cost between $200 and $600 per tree. This includes removing selected branches to improve health and airflow, with prices varying based on tree size and density.

Advanced Thinning and Removal - For more extensive thinning or removal of larger trees, costs can range from $800 to $2,500 or more per tree. Factors influencing price include tree height, location, and accessibility.

Maintenance and Follow-up - Ongoing maintenance or follow-up thinning services often cost between $150 and $400 per session. Regular assessments help maintain healthy canopy conditions and may be recommended annually or biannually.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
